Manpower are currently recruiting for X5 Manufacturing / Production staff to work for our national client based on the outskirts of Bury St Edmunds. You will be joining at an exciting time as they look to expand their work force and become their UK's specialist site.

Part of the role will include metal reconditioning, loading and unloading trailers, machine operating loading and unloading of pallets and other repetitive manual handling tasks, and is based partially outside, under shelter, in all weathers.

Applicants will preferably have experience of working in a production environment, although full training will be given.

The ideal candidate will possess a positive, responsible attitude and be able to work as part of a team. You will also be reliable, have strong safety awareness, and be able to work using a high level of accuracy and attention to detail. Good numeric and communication skills are also required, as is the ability to follow verbal instructions.

You will be working 42.5 hours a week with over time also available. Working hours are on a 2 weekly shift rotation ( Days and Late shifts )

Key responsibilities will include:

  • Contribute to a safety-first operation and incident-free workplace. Report any incident, injury or near miss and contribute to the hazard spot program.
  • Operate within and comply with all SHE, including expected PPE, guidance
  • Ensure understanding of standards in the cylinder reconditioning process
  • Segregate cylinders in line with mandatory specifications
  • Recondition cylinders in line with mandatory specifications
  • Scrap cylinders in line with mandatory specifications
  • Carry-out faulty cylinder investigation and reporting

This is long term work, and we offer 28 days holiday per year, a contributory pension scheme, and a subsidised canteen and free parking on site.

Please note that there is no public transport to the site, so your own transport is a must, and you must be over 18 years to work on site.
